The Great North Museum Project in Newcastle Upon Tyne has appointed production company Pure Artwork to work alongside a London design agency on the implementation of its design guidelines.

The Leeds based company will aid Nick Bell Design in creating the wayfinding and displays for the £26million redevelopment of the Hancock Museum, which will bring together collections from three existing museums – the Hancock Museum, the Shefton Museum and the Museum of Antiques. The fourth partner, The Hatton Gallery will remain at its current venue although it will be managed by the Great North Museum.
